The World Economy

National Institute Economic Review, 2002
Global economic activity clearly rebounded in the first half of this year. The pick-up from the weakness in the latter half of 2001 was especially marked in North America and Asia, with GDP rising by around 1½ per cent in the first quarter in the United States, Canada and Japan.
